The Irish Driver’s License System
The Irish driving license is governed by the Road Safety Authority (RSA) and is divided into a number of classifications, depending on the kind of car one plans to drive. The main classes consist of:
| License Category | Description |
|---|---|
| A | Motorcycles |
| B | Vehicles |
| C | Heavy lorries |
| D | Buses |
| E | Trailers |
To obtain a chauffeur’s license in Ireland, candidates need to initially request a student permit, go through obligatory training, and after that finish the driving test. Post-training, effective prospects get a full motorist’s license, which must be restored regularly.
Steps to Obtaining a Driver’s License
1. Apply for a Learner Permit
Before one can drive, they need to make an application for a learner permit. This is the momentary permit issued to brand-new chauffeurs. Secret requirements consist of:
- Being at least 17 years of ages for a car license (category B).
- Completing the application (called Form D201).
- Providing personal identification and residence information.
- Paying the appropriate charge.
2. Total Driver Theory Test
After receiving the learner permit, candidates should pass the Driver Theory Test. This test assesses knowledge of road indications, rules, and safe driving practices. It can be booked online, and it requires a charge.
3. Obligatory Essential Driver Training (EDT)
Once the theory test is successfully finished, the next action is necessary Essential Driver Training. This consists of 12 lessons targeted at improving driving abilities and is performed by an RSA-approved instructor.
4. Gain Experience with Learner Permit
Throughout this phase, student motorists should log a needed amount of supervised driving hours. It is imperative to adhere to particular restrictions such as not driving at night and making sure a completely certified chauffeur accompanies them.
5. Take and Pass the Driving Test
After completing the required hours of training and practice, candidates can schedule their driving test. Functions of the test consist of:
- A useful evaluation of driving skills.
- A set cost for the test booking.
- A valid learner permit throughout the test.
6. Get a Full Driver’s License
Upon passing the driving test, candidates can use for their full motorist’s license. Required documentation consists of:
- Test pass certificate.
- Learner permit.
- Individual identification.
When the application is processed, the driver’s license will be delivered to the candidate.
7. License Delivery Process
The delivery of the motorist’s license is usually managed by the National Driver’s License Service (NDLS). An applicant can expect their driver’s license to arrive within:
| Processing Time | Delivery Method |
|---|---|
| 10 working days | Registered post |
| 5– 8 working days | In-person collection available |
8. Renewing Your Driver’s License
Motorist’s licenses in Ireland are not irreversible and must be restored. The basic renewal process consists of:
- Application Form: Completing the appropriate kind.
- Documents: Showing evidence of identity and residency.
- Payment: Fee appropriate for renewal.
Typical FAQs Regarding Irish Driver’s License Delivery
1. How long does it take to get my driver’s license after passing the test?
Normally, you should get your chauffeur’s license within 10 working days after the application is processed.
2. What if my license does not arrive after the specified time?
If your driver’s license does not get here within 10 working days, you should call the National Driver’s License Service straight for assistance.
3. Can I track my driver’s license delivery status?
Currently, the NDLS does not use a live tracking function for motorist’s license deliveries. Nevertheless, you can ask about your application status.
4. Is it possible to speed up the delivery process?
Unfortunately, there is no expedited service formally readily available for chauffeur’s license delivery.
5. What should I do if I lose my chauffeur’s license?

In case of a lost license, you need to report it to the authorities right away and apply for a replacement through the NDLS, which involves submitting an application and paying the replacement cost.
